Transaction 21dc646232c15a1e64b5bf55cb6c81aaecf4bf045d16a4e9fdb734f610b97390

3 Input
2 Outputs
  • 21dc646232c15a1e64b5bf55cb6c81aaecf4bf045d16a4e9fdb734f610b97390:0
  • value  3000000000
    address  1PvBxDf6K71sdj2Dz7fsDNoQfGUEUdbX4y
  • 21dc646232c15a1e64b5bf55cb6c81aaecf4bf045d16a4e9fdb734f610b97390:1
  • value  3456207
    address  198PoZf39MjcqWFY1sG1d4r4X3aPRRWC7